The pro is fairly obvious: - Some books and articles have color graphics and illustrations (e.g. Color photos, color reproductions of art, etc. ) which can only be appreciated fully in color. The cons are also not too difficult to discern: - The cost of the color screen may push the product price higher, though it might instead push down the cost of the B/W Kindle. - More power needed by the screen reduces battery life, both per charge, and overall in number of days after which the battery must be replaced.

- The above leads to increased environmental impact from more discarded batteries. - May cause higher cost for "color version" of books, though it's also possible that B/W versions would become discounted instead. If the technology supports it, perhaps there would be a B/W setting for the color screen which might reduce the power consumption, making this the best of both worlds, as most books and articles do not require color at all, or if they do, it is for a small subset of their pages.
